On Sunday night the annual EE British Academy Film Awards took place in England’s capital, at the London Opera House. Many of the film industries biggest & brightest star headed to London for the black tie awards, walking the final big red carpet before the prestigious Oscars. Nimrat Kaur was a breathtakingly beautiful presence on the British red carpet wearing Georges Hobeika, donning this baby pink caped dress with floral appliqué & embellishments on the upper bodice and a plunging keyhole too. Her perfect bouffant hairstyle & barely there par kohl-rimmed eye makeup with a nude manicure and minimal jewels were truly the perfect finish.
Lady in Red
Actress Julianne Moore attended in a square plunging red gown by Tom Ford, which featured full sleeves, a roundneck collar and was half velvet-half crepe texured. Her hair was styled into Old Hollywood waves with a black manicure and Chopard jewellery. Julianne Moore also won the award for Best Leading Actress in ‘Still Alice’.
Dianna Agron wore a red Lanvin dress to the awards, wearing a crimson red petal sweetheart neckline number with a grosgrain sash, that she styled with a gold cuff bracelet and black decorative strappy sandals. White Hot
BAFTA nominee Amy Adams attended in a white column dress by Lanvin, which featured an embellished waistband & a tassel belt and was sleeveless too. The custom-made crepe dress looked great on the actress, styled with a straight hairstyle tucked behind one ear and simple accessories.
Supporting her husband on the night, Anne-Marie Duff wore a white gown to the awards, which had a fair bit going on; strategically placed bodice with a sheer polka dot overlay and sheer sleeves, rib-pleated waistband details with a pleated full length skirt to finish. Her dress was styled with a messy braided updo, coral lipstick and barely there makeup.
DJ & presenter Sarah-Jane Crawford worked the red carpet while werking the red carpet donning this blush pink Ariella Couture dress. Her look featured a plunging bodice with a lace overlay and a relaxed mermaid fitted skirt. Her dark waves, smokey cat eyes and minimal jewels made for a picture perfect look.
A Splash of Colour
Felicity Jones attended the BAFTAs in this Christian Dior gown, with its black sleeveless bodice and the floral appliqué embroidered pale pink silk ballgown skirt. A mid-parted fringed updo and sparkling earrings with smokey eyes and a black manicure completed the nominee’s look.
Gugu Mbatha-Raw wore a sheen look on the red carpet, donning a lilac Prada gown that featured black crystal-studded trims. A pink lip and sparkly earrings with a black box clutch rounded up the young actress’ look for the evening.
Wearing an electric blue look was Titziana Rocca, whose asymmetrical gown also featured a triangular peekaboo lace panel on the waist and a thigh high split, which showed off her blue pumps. Deep waves and smokey eyes completed the look.
BAFTA nominee Reese Witherspoon was also in attendance donning a dark shade of purple to the awards. Her Stella McCartney gown featured a plunging neckline with a simple fitted skirt & train, that was every bit sexy as it was classy. James Bond actress Léa Seadoux was a true beauty in her canary yellow Prada gown that had cut outs on the waist and capped sleeves. She definitely turned heads in her subtly sexy but elegant choice, which featured gathered detailing on the bodice and a soft-pleated skirt, styled with Chopard jewels, a curled bob and red lipstick to boot. Exquisite & Embellished
Julie Walters walked the red carpet in this sparkling all-over sequined dress. Her long sleeve was worn with a black sheer wrap that featured seaweed-like trims. Drop earrings and sparkling cuff bracelets with a wispy hairstyle & kohl-rimmed eyes completed this look.
Actress Keira Knightley continued her beautiful maternity style donning a girly Giambattista Valli midi dress. The very pale pink bodice featured floral appliqué, while the fully lined skirt featured an embroidered tulle overlay. Soft waves and subtle smokey eyes finished up this look.
Attending with her nominated husband Eddie Redmayne, Hannah Bagshawe wore this military green gown that featured glitter embroidered lace with feather-like capped sleeves and a high neckline. A wispy updo and gold clutch finished up her look beautifully. Eddie Redmayne also won the BAFTA award for Best Leading Actor in ‘The Theory of Everything’, huge congratulations to him!
Edith Bowman wore an extraordinary look to the awards, donning a lace scalloped plunging gown with an all-over mini floral printed body and pockets on the hips. A fringed updo and pearl drop earrings rounded up her ensemble.
Going for a girly colour, actress Olivia Grant wore this pastel pink v-cut shift dress with a beaded overlay and bra-like cut outs on the bodice. It was sexy & flirty but still quite sweet, and was teamed with a metallic box clutch, barely there makeup and soft waves.
Black Beauties
Rosamund Pike attended the BAFTAs in this simplistic black bespoke Roland Mouret halter dress that featured signature folds. Although it’s not a fabulous choice, the chic look was styled with beautiful green & silver Bvlgari earrings and a pavé bracelet.
Attending with her husband, Sophie Hunter looked lovely in her LBD that featured a narrow keyhole detail and halterneck ribbon. I adore her styling for this look a lot; statement drop earrings, a bangle bracelet, barely there makeup and a chic updo.
Hofit Golan definitely pushed the red carpet boundaries for this awards show, donning a fun & flirty look by Stephane Rolland. Her asymmetrical dress featured a cut out on the bodice, showing off some cheeky cleavage, with a belted sheer overlay waterfall skirt that was printed with gold & black stars. She wore matching designer gold & black sandals, and styled with a Zagliani bag and jewels by De Grisogono, finishing up with a quiff hairstyle and cat eyes. Actress Claire Forlani also opted for a simple black ensemble, donning this velvet strapless sweetheart gown that worked curves into her slender body beautifully. A statement necklace and box clutch with barely there makeup & an updo completed the look.
Alma Jodorowsky wore Stella McCartney to the awards, walking the red carpet in a midi dress that featured sheer panels on the upper bodice and sleeves with circular appliqué all over. She added Chanel shoes and a handbag to the look, finishing up with a sideswept hairstyle and red lipstick.
